I tried to cancel my order 3 days after placing it, got nowhere with Wigsway so opened a dispute through Paypal. After weeks of being given the run around by Paypal the wigs were delivered anyway. I immediately returned them to the address which was on their package via Royal Mail tracking and signed for. I have a copy of the scrawled signature and details of where and when it was delivered back to them. They only had to simply deny receipt of the return and Paypal paid them my 338 pounds and closed the case. Me, I have lost all this money and have no wigs, which I would not have worn anyway...
